Grace Shields has lived an ordinary life: she lives with her older brother, goes to high school with her two best friends, and, for the most part, deals with ordinary teenage problems like school projects and crushes. Except for the part where she can make lightning crackle in her hands and has an older brother who moonlights as the superhero Tempest, controlling the wind. She trains every day to eventually join her brother out on the streets and become a superhero in her own right. But as an unexpected event sends her life spiraling down a different path, secrets threaten to tear her world apart, along with the mystery of a dangerous threat lurking underneath the surface. As the life she had always dreamed of turns out to be darker than she imagined, she scrambles to hold her life together as her secrets threaten to swallow her whole as the foundation of her life seemingly crumbles from underneath her feet. Imagine the second you're born, a consultant removes you from your mother's grasp and runs a battery of genetic and physiological tests on you. Thirty minutes later they give you a score out of one hundred which denotes your level of perfection. If your score is above eighty and you work hard to maintain that score you will have a charmed life; well fed, well-rewarded, spoiled. But fall below eighty and you're labelled Flawed, and life will not be so kind. Hannah is adopted by a Flawed family when her birth parents choose their social standing over their daughter and endures a life of struggle, hunger and service. One day Hannah is escorted to the regional government office and told that the Consultant who delivered her, who labelled her Flawed got it wrong! Now, she is being relocated back to her birth parents, to live as one of the Ninety-Five- all medically and legally judged as perfect. Entering this new life Hannah has an impossible decision to make which puts not only hers, but the lives of everyone she cares about at great risk. "The Numbered- where no one wants to be number one".
